Transcript here. SDNY Grand Jury has indicted nine Iranians for cybertheft.
The indictment alleges that the defendants worked on behalf of the Iranian government, specifically the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ps.
They hacked the computer systems of approximately 320 universities in 22 countries. 144 of the victims are American universities. The defendants stole research that cost the universities approximately $3.4 billion to procure and maintain.
The stolen information was used by the Revolutionary Guard or sold for profit in Iran.
